Latest Patents

One of his latest patents is an image-based refractive index measuring system. This system comprises an optical device and an electronic device. The optical device guides external light that passes through an analyte. The electronic device includes an image capture module, an image analysis module, and a display module. The image capture module generates a first image by capturing the external light source. The image analysis module receives the first image and analyzes it to generate an analytical result, which includes the refractive index of the analyte. The display module then receives and displays this analytical result.

Another significant patent is the gamma dose rate measurement system. This invention includes a shielding device and an electronic device. The shielding device masks visible light, allowing only gamma rays to pass through. The electronic device consists of a sensing module, an image analysis module, and a display module. The sensing module generates a current signal after detecting the gamma ray. The image analysis module processes this current signal to produce an analysis result, which includes the total gamma dose rate and a gamma energy spectrum. The display module is responsible for showcasing the analysis result.
